Heim >Web-Frontend >js-Tutorial >Sprechen Sie im JavaScript_Javascript-Tutorial über Arrays, Sammlungen und Effizienz

Sprechen Sie im JavaScript_Javascript-Tutorial über Arrays, Sammlungen und Effizienz

黄舟
黄舟Original
2016-12-20 15:12:11872Durchsuche

Array ist ein internes Objekt, das von JavaScript bereitgestellt wird. Wir können die darin enthaltenen Elemente zusätzlich hinzufügen (pushen) und löschen Im Array verwenden wir JavaScript. Kann es andere Sammlungen enthalten?


Aufgrund der Sprachfunktionen von JavaScript können wir Eigenschaften zu allgemeinen Objekten dynamisch hinzufügen und löschen. Daher kann Object auch als eine spezielle Sammlung von JS betrachtet werden. Vergleichen wir die Eigenschaften von Array und Objekt:

Array:

Neu: var ary = new Array(); oder var ary = [];

Hinzufügen: ary. push(value);

Delete: delete ary[n];

Traverse: for ( var i=0 ; i f3fec32fa8f8955ca8b0e8ba9ff73185 . Die am wenigsten effiziente Methode ist for(in). Wenn die Sammlung zu groß ist, versuchen Sie, for(in) nicht zum Durchlaufen zu verwenden.


Das Obige ist der Inhalt des Javascript-Tutorials zu Arrays, Sammlungen und Effizienz in JavaScript. Weitere verwandte Inhalte finden Sie auf der chinesischen PHP-Website (www.php .cn)!


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n